Maybe we need liability for software vendors? That's a common suggestion, but since no-one knows how to make completely secure systems yet, I don't think it's that simple. If you're talking about a general presumption that anyone selling software that has a security vulnerability becomes liable for any consequential losses, then it seems likely to result in only large businesses with the war chest to fight a liabilit…
The price of providing a basic level of security should be priced into the product! The fact that someone can go out there and buy an IOT camera that will be used to DDOS my server is a negative externality that constitutes a market failure. I want sketchy IOT manufacturer 32XB123 to be forced to buy liability insurance for that.
